typedef能提高程序可读性和可移植性(如typedef char BYTE)。

定义: typedef 类型名 标识符

例如:

typedef int INTEGER;
INTEGER i,j,k;typedef char STRING[80];
STRING str;typedef char *PCHAR;
PCHAR p1,p2;

c语言typedef类型定义相关推荐

  1. C语言bool类型定义

    在我们的C语言程序中,经常用到布尔类型,但是C标准并不支持布尔类型,但我们可以自己实现其类型,实现代码如下: typedef enum { false = 0, ture = !false }bool ...

  2. c 语言字符串类型定义,C字符串类型定义

    你不能在C中创建string类型的变量,因为"string"不是一个类型. 根据定义,"字符串"是"由第一个空字符终止并包括第一个空字符的连续字符序列 ...

  3. C语言字符串类型定义(二维字符数组模拟连续存储多个字符串)(以小凡点名为例)

    经过dev-Cpp检验 #define _CRT_SECURE_NO_WARNINGS /* 老师让小凡来完成点名,让小凡在早自习的时候就点好名.老师给了小凡名单,小凡只要照着名单点名就好了是不是很简 ...

  4. C语言 typedef 和 #define详解

    类型定义 (typedef) 摘自 <C程序设计语言>6.7节 C语言提供了一个称为typedef的功能,它用来建立新的数据类型名,例如,声明 typedef int Length; 将L ...

  5. c语言long int字节,C语言基本类型之long long int

    大家都知道int在linux系统下默认是占4个字节,数值表示范围是:-2147483648~2147483647.即使是无符号unsigned int类型表示范围:0-4294967295,大约42亿 ...

  6. C语言typedef:给类型起一个别名

    C语言typedef:给类型起一个别名 C语言允许为一个数据类型起一个新的别名,起别名的目的不是为了提高程序运行效率,而是为了编码方便.例如有一个结构体的名字是 stu,要想定义一个结构体变量就得这样 ...

  7. c语言typedef怎么自定义函数,C语言 typedef:给类型起一个别名

    C语言允许为一个数据类型起一个新的别名,就像给人起"绰号"一样. 起别名的目的不是为了提高程序运行效率,而是为了编码方便.例如有一个结构体的名字是 stu,要想定义一个结构体变量就 ...

  8. c语言用typedef定义结构体,C语言结构体定义 typedef struct

    c语言规范,定义结构体: typedef struct ANSWER_HEADER { u8 u8Type; u8 u8Code; u32 u32TimeStamp; struct ANSWER_HE ...

  9. linux c 结构体参数,C语言结构体类型定义

    C语言结构体类型定义 结构体的定义形式如下: struct 结构体名 { 结构体成员 }: 结构体变量的定义方式有三种: 1.先定义结构体,再定义变量: eg. struct student{ cha ...

最新文章

  1. Java学习总结:28
  2. Android用省略号替换“...”
  3. Linux下实现apache代理tomcat
  4. Hadoop集群管理与NFS网关
  5. flash,flex,actionscript的关系
  6. ITK:就地过滤图像
  7. c语言基础知识 面试,c语言面试最必考的十道试题,求职必看!!!
  8. 华为服务器报错信息,厂商 push 不通排查指南
  9. Ubuntu20.04安装OpenCV3.4.15
  10. 使用计算机粘贴板的步骤,电脑自带剪贴板怎么打开?剪贴板打开教程
  11. linux pcre路径,PCRE和Nginx安装问题
  12. 五万美元的年薪是如何花光的
  13. 获取list中出现频数最多的元素
  14. 笔记本计算机无法启动怎么解决,笔记本开机进不了系统,教您笔记本开机无法进入系统怎么办...
  15. 华为笔记本电脑驱动Linux版,华为改进Linux笔记本电脑驱动程序
  16. 使用关键字搜索公众号文章,
  17. 如何把安卓机用出Ipad的自由感 | 安卓党电子手帐
  18. eclipse安装WindousBuilder为什么在项目里不显示
  19. Python绘制小红花
  20. 利用 FFMPEG 批量提取指定起止时间视频片段

热门文章

  1. 哈工大演化计算PPT1(精译)
  2. 做PPT用到的实用且免费的网站
  3. 【无标题】MySQL优化
  4. MindManager中文版免费下载使用序列号V20.0.334
  5. 满二叉树与完全二叉树的区别
  6. android usb 检测工具,Android:如何检测已连接的USB设备?
  7. 爬取《令人心动的offer2》13万弹幕,看网友是如何评价的
  8. Spring新的官网,找不到Spring下载地址
  9. 决策树模型预测宽带用户流失率
  10. S120变频器通过Starter软件设置常用参数